Electro-galvanized steel binding iron wire is a specialized form of galvanized wire that combines the benefits of electroplating with the strength of steel. Unlike traditional hot-dip galvanizing, this process offers a more cost-effective solution while maintaining robust corrosion resistance. The wire features a thick galvanized layer, making it ideal for applications where exposure to harsh environmental conditions is a concern.
Wire Diameter (BWG) | Wire Diameter (mm) | Zinc Coating (g/㎡) | Tensile Strength (MPa) | Packing Weight (kg) |
---|---|---|---|---|
25-4 | 0.5-6 | 10-40 | 30-55 | 1-1000 |

Cold-dip galvanizing involves applying a zinc coating through electroplating. The zinc layer is typically thinner than that of hot-dip galvanizing, resulting in a brighter, silvery-white appearance with a yellowish tint. This method is often preferred for smaller components where a uniform coating is essential.
Hot-dip galvanizing involves immersing the steel in molten zinc, creating a thicker, more durable coating. The resulting surface is shiny and white, offering superior corrosion resistance. This method is ideal for large structures and outdoor applications where longevity is critical.
